Do they send post-II R's throughout the cycle or just at the end?
You should hear back in about 4-8 weeks after your interview. They waitlist most people, accept some, and reject some. If you are waitlisted and do not end up getting off the waitlist, then you would know sometime in April/May/June.

Does anyone know what the chances are of getting off the waitlist (OOS) at GW?
GW's post-II acceptance is about 28% (directly accepted and WL->accepted), so realistically quite low. However, low =/= impossible and there is always a good amount of movement starting April for interviewees of all months.
